What kind of bug or animal does a worm eat?

What kind of bug or animal does a worm eat?

Ground-Crawling Enemies Small lizards, salamanders and toads eat worms and wormlike insect larvae. Ground-crawling insects, particularly ground beetles, along with centipedes and flatworms, also prey on worms and similar creatures.

What animal does a worm eat?

Worms are long, thin, boneless animals that live in the ground and are decomposers that break down dead plant and animal materials in the soil. Some of the things that worms eat include dead plants, live plants, dead animals, animal poo, and other microscopic animals.

What animals do earthworms eat?

Their nutrition comes from things in soil, such as decaying roots and leaves. Animal manures are an important food source for earthworms. They eat living organisms such as nematodes, protozoans, rotifers, bacteria, fungi in soil. Worms will also feed on the decomposing remains of other animals.

Do earthworms eat other bugs?

Earthworms eat dead and decaying matter, typically plant-based, but may eat small dead insects, such as dead ants.

Do earthworms poop?

Leftover soil particles and undigested organic matter pass out of the worm through the rectum and anus in the form of castings, or worm poop. Worm poop is dark, moist, soil-colored, and very rich in nutrients.

What are the tiny white things in my worm bin?

Most people shudder when they see white maggots in their worm bin or compost pile. These maggots are the larvae of “compost-dwelling” soldier flies. ... In fact, these larvae play a role in breaking down and recycling nutrients back into the soil.

Do raccoons eat earthworms?

Yards. Raccoons can damage lawns (especially recently sodded ones) by digging for earthworms and grubs. Often they simply reach under the strips and feel around for their meal, pulling out the grubs and worms without causing any damage, but sometimes they'll tear up the sod.
